California home charging cost for the 2027 Cadillac OPTIQ AWD 11kW Charger

At California's residential electricity rate of 33.17¢/kWh, a 2027 Cadillac OPTIQ AWD 11kW Charger (rated 34 kWh per 100 miles by the EPA) costs $11.29 to drive 100 miles on home charging, against $16.02 for the same distance in a car averaging 25.5 mpg on gasoline at $4.085/gallon. Charging at home is cheaper than gas here: 29.6% less than gas per mile, here specifically.

What a year of driving costs

At fueleconomy.gov's default of 15,000 annual miles, the 2027 Cadillac OPTIQ AWD 11kW Charger costs roughly $1,693 a year to charge at home in California, against roughly $2,403 a year for an equivalent gas car. That's a savings of about $710 a year.

Filling up the 2027 Cadillac OPTIQ AWD 11kW Charger, in dollars

Covering the 2027 Cadillac OPTIQ AWD 11kW Charger's EPA-rated 303-mile range takes about 103.1 kWh, which costs about $34.2 at California's residential rate — figured from the EPA's own combined range and consumption numbers, not the pack's nameplate capacity.

Getting set up to charge a 2027 Cadillac OPTIQ AWD 11kW Charger at home

The numbers above assume Level 2 home charging is already in place — the electrical work behind that is a real, separate cost that varies by panel, wiring, and local labor rates, not something this page's per-mile math includes.
